The Foundations: A Brief History of Dog Breeding

The domestication of dogs is a story that stretches back tens of thousands of years, a testament to the enduring partnership between humans and canines. Early humans likely selected dogs based on traits that were beneficial for survival, such as hunting prowess, guarding instincts, and herding abilities. This early form of selective breeding, albeit unintentional, laid the groundwork for the development of distinct dog types.

As human societies evolved, so too did the roles of dogs. Different geographical regions and cultural needs led to the development of dogs specialized for specific tasks. For example, hardy breeds like the Siberian Husky were bred for pulling sleds across vast snowy landscapes, while agile breeds like the Border Collie were honed for herding livestock in challenging terrains. This process of selective breeding, driven by practical necessity, resulted in the emergence of recognizable dog types with consistent physical and behavioral characteristics.

The Victorian era marked a turning point in the formalization of dog breeds. Dog shows became increasingly popular, and kennel clubs were established to regulate breeding practices and maintain breed standards. These organizations played a crucial role in defining and preserving the characteristics of established breeds, as well as fostering the development of new ones. Breed standards, which outline the ideal physical and temperamental traits for each breed, became the guiding principle for breeders striving to produce dogs that conformed to the established ideal.

The Science Behind Dog Breeds: Genetics and Selective Breeding

The remarkable diversity of dog breeds is a testament to the power of genetics. All dog breeds belong to the same species, Canis lupus familiaris, yet they exhibit a wide range of physical and behavioral traits. This variation is primarily due to differences in their genetic makeup, which have been shaped by centuries of selective breeding.

Selective breeding is the process by which humans intentionally choose which dogs to breed based on desired traits. By consistently selecting dogs with specific characteristics, breeders can gradually increase the frequency of genes associated with those traits in subsequent generations. Over time, this process can lead to the development of distinct breeds with unique physical appearances, temperaments, and abilities.

While selective breeding has been instrumental in creating the dog breeds we know today, it is important to acknowledge that it can also have unintended consequences. Breeding for specific physical traits, such as a flattened face in brachycephalic breeds like Bulldogs and Pugs, can lead to health problems, such as breathing difficulties. Responsible breeders prioritize the health and well-being of their dogs and avoid breeding practices that could compromise their quality of life.

Understanding the genetic basis of dog breeds is becoming increasingly sophisticated thanks to advances in genomics. Researchers can now identify specific genes that are associated with certain traits, such as coat color, size, and disease susceptibility. This knowledge is helping breeders make more informed decisions about which dogs to breed and is paving the way for the development of genetic tests that can screen dogs for inherited health conditions.

The Role of Breed Standards

Breed standards are detailed descriptions that outline the ideal characteristics of a particular breed. These standards cover a wide range of traits, including physical appearance (size, coat, color, head shape), temperament, and movement. Breed standards serve as a guide for breeders, helping them to select dogs that conform to the established ideal and to maintain the consistency of the breed.

Breed standards are not static documents; they can be revised and updated over time to reflect changes in breeding practices or to address health concerns. Kennel clubs, such as the American Kennel Club (AKC) and the United Kennel Club (UKC), are responsible for maintaining and updating breed standards. These organizations also play a role in regulating dog shows and promoting responsible breeding practices.

It’s crucial to remember that breed standards represent an ideal, and individual dogs may not always conform perfectly to the standard. Moreover, an overemphasis on breed standards can sometimes lead to the selection of dogs with exaggerated physical features that can compromise their health and well-being. Responsible breeders prioritize the overall health and temperament of their dogs over strict adherence to the breed standard.

Genetic Bottlenecks and Breed Health

The creation of dog breeds has often involved small founding populations, leading to what’s known as a genetic bottleneck. This means that the genetic diversity within a breed can be limited, making them more susceptible to inherited diseases. When a breed is founded by a small number of individuals, certain genes, including those that cause diseases, can become more common in the population.

Addressing this issue requires careful management of breeding programs. Breeders should strive to maintain genetic diversity within their breeds by avoiding inbreeding and outcrossing to unrelated lines. Genetic testing can also help identify carriers of disease-causing genes, allowing breeders to make informed decisions about which dogs to breed and to reduce the risk of producing affected offspring.

Beyond Genetics: Environmental and Societal Influences

While genetics play a crucial role in determining the characteristics of a dog breed, environmental and societal factors also exert a significant influence. The environment in which a dog is raised can affect its physical development, temperament, and behavior. For example, dogs that are exposed to a variety of experiences during their critical socialization period are more likely to be well-adjusted and confident.

Societal influences also play a role in shaping dog breeds. The popularity of certain breeds can fluctuate over time, driven by factors such as media portrayals, celebrity ownership, and perceived trends. These trends can influence breeding practices and can sometimes lead to the overbreeding of popular breeds, which can have negative consequences for their health and welfare.

Furthermore, the changing roles of dogs in society are also influencing breeding practices. As more dogs are kept as companion animals, there is increasing emphasis on temperament and trainability. Breeders are responding to this demand by selecting for dogs that are friendly, well-behaved, and easy to train.

What is a dog breed, and how does it differ from a general dog type?

A dog breed is a specific group of dogs that consistently produce offspring with similar and predictable characteristics, including physical appearance, temperament, and behavior. These characteristics are passed down through generations due to controlled breeding practices focused on selecting for specific traits. This intentional selection, often over many generations, creates a population that is genetically distinct and recognizable.

A dog type, on the other hand, refers to a broader categorization based on general function or appearance. For instance, “herding dog” is a type, but a Border Collie is a specific breed within that type. Dog types are less strictly defined than breeds and can encompass a wider variety of appearances and genetic backgrounds. Type classifications are useful for understanding a dog’s general tendencies, but they don’t have the same level of genetic consistency or predictability as breed classifications.

What are the primary factors that determine a dog’s breed?

The breed of a dog is primarily determined by its genetic lineage and the established breeding standards defined by kennel clubs and breed organizations. These standards outline specific physical traits, temperament guidelines, and acceptable breed-specific health characteristics. Breeders who adhere to these standards aim to maintain the breed’s integrity and ensure that puppies inherit the desired traits.

Furthermore, DNA testing has become an increasingly valuable tool for determining a dog’s breed. These tests analyze a dog’s genetic makeup and compare it to a database of known breed markers, providing an estimate of the dog’s breed composition. While DNA tests aren’t foolproof and can sometimes be influenced by the completeness of the database or the presence of mixed ancestry, they offer valuable insights into a dog’s potential heritage, particularly for dogs with unknown or mixed parentage.

What role do kennel clubs play in defining and maintaining dog breeds?

Kennel clubs, such as the American Kennel Club (AKC) and the United Kennel Club (UKC), play a significant role in defining and maintaining dog breeds by establishing breed standards and regulating dog shows. These standards outline the ideal physical characteristics, temperament, and movement for each breed, serving as a guideline for breeders aiming to produce dogs that conform to the breed ideal. Kennel clubs also maintain breed registries, tracking the pedigrees of registered dogs and ensuring the integrity of breed lines.

Furthermore, kennel clubs promote responsible breeding practices and encourage breeders to prioritize the health and well-being of their dogs. They also organize and oversee dog shows and competitions, providing a platform for breeders to showcase their dogs and compare them against the breed standard. Through these activities, kennel clubs help preserve breed characteristics, promote responsible breeding, and foster a community of breeders and enthusiasts dedicated to the preservation of dog breeds.

How accurate are dog DNA tests in determining a dog’s breed?

Dog DNA tests can be a helpful tool in determining a dog’s breed, but their accuracy varies depending on several factors. The accuracy of the test is influenced by the size and completeness of the DNA database used for comparison. A larger database with a greater representation of different breeds will generally yield more accurate results. Additionally, the presence of mixed ancestry can complicate the results, making it more difficult to pinpoint the exact breed composition.

It’s also important to remember that DNA tests provide an estimate based on genetic markers and not a definitive statement of breed purity. While a test may indicate a significant percentage of a particular breed, it doesn’t guarantee that the dog will exhibit all the traits typically associated with that breed. Furthermore, some less common breeds may not be well-represented in the databases, leading to less accurate results. Therefore, while DNA tests can be informative, they should be interpreted with caution and considered alongside other factors, such as the dog’s physical characteristics and behavior.

What are the potential health concerns associated with specific dog breeds?

Many dog breeds are predisposed to specific health concerns due to their genetic makeup and selective breeding for certain traits. These breed-specific health issues can range from skeletal problems, such as hip dysplasia in large breeds like German Shepherds, to respiratory issues, such as brachycephalic syndrome in breeds with short noses like Bulldogs. Certain breeds are also more susceptible to specific types of cancer, heart conditions, or eye disorders.

Responsible breeders prioritize the health and well-being of their dogs by conducting genetic testing and screening for breed-specific health issues. This helps them make informed breeding decisions and reduce the risk of passing on these conditions to future generations. Potential dog owners should research the common health concerns associated with the breeds they are considering and choose breeders who prioritize health testing and responsible breeding practices. Understanding these potential health risks allows owners to be proactive about preventative care and early detection of any health problems.

Is it possible for a dog to be considered a “mixed breed” even if its DNA test shows a high percentage of one particular breed?

Yes, a dog can be considered a mixed breed even if a DNA test shows a high percentage of one particular breed. This is because the term “mixed breed” generally refers to a dog with ancestry from multiple breeds, regardless of the specific percentages. Even if a DNA test indicates that a dog is, for example, 75% Labrador Retriever, the presence of other breeds in its ancestry still classifies it as a mixed breed.

The cutoff for considering a dog “purebred” versus “mixed breed” is often based on pedigree documentation and breed registry requirements, which typically require several generations of exclusively purebred lineage. If a dog lacks this documented purebred lineage, or if its DNA test reveals significant percentages of multiple breeds, it is generally classified as a mixed breed, regardless of the highest single breed percentage. Therefore, the label “mixed breed” reflects the complex and often undocumented genetic heritage of many dogs, even those with a dominant breed in their DNA.
